A gap between the frame of the sash and the frame may be the cause of your uPVC windows not closing properly. This can lead to drafts, but it could also cause water damage and damp. To determine this, try putting a piece paper between the frame and the sash to see if the frame can be closed.

To fix it, you'll need to take off the seals surrounding the frame and the sash. You will then need to remove the locking mechanism from its position inside the frame. To get the gearbox out you'll need a flat torch or screwdriver. Once you have removed the gearbox, you will need to replace it with a brand new one that is the same model and size.

Repair window frames made of UPVC

If your uPVC windows are damaged, have cracks or holes, or even a broken window seal it is important to repair them immediately. These issues can cause the glass to become cloudy, and could result in water leaks. In addition, the damage to the frames can decrease the insulation value of your home, which can result in higher energy bills. Most of these issues are easily repaired by a professional or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repairs are less expensive than replacement of the entire unit, but in some cases it is better to replace the entire unit. This is especially true when the frame is damaged beyond repair. The cost of the UPVC replacement window is affected by several factors, including the kind of material used and the amount of labor required. A complete replacement could cost between $100 and $1000 for a window. The price will differ depending on the extent of the damage and whether or not a new installation is needed.

It is crucial to clean UPVC windows on a regular basis to avoid the buildup of dirt and moisture. You can avoid costly repairs in the future. In general, it is recommended to do this two times a year. You may also apply WD-40 for lubricating the moving parts on your UPVC windows. Before cleaning the frame, it's best to get rid of any dust or cobwebs with a soft bristle brush. You can sand any scratches on the frames in order to make them appear brand new.
